Be wary when you see wly* completesaving.co.uk

My daughter has just discovered that £15 has been debited from her account every month since September. She has contacted the company, who have sent her automated emails informing her about how to cancel her account. Although the company probably do have a number of benefits, my daughter cannot remember filling in a form to register with them or agreeing to their terms and conditions. She is a student and has not got enough money for her rent most months so she would not have knowingly signed up for a company that costs £15 per month to join. She would like a refund of £150 but does not know what more she can do to get it. Be wary of filling out extra forms when you buy online. Any advice about how she could get her money back would be gratefully received.
 
Complete Savings responded on 30/10/2019:
 
Hi Joanie, omplete Savings is an online savings programme for people who shop online regularly. The only way you can become a member is by entering your details on the sign-up form & agree to the terms & conditions of the programme. Please contact me directly at [email protected] if you and your daughter need assistance. Kind regards, Mary, The Complete Savings team

Unknowingly signed up and charged for membership!!!
 
My partner ordered some train tickets for himself and I through trainline and appears to have unknowingly been signed up for a complete savings membership. Only been made aware of this today due to complete savings deducting money from his bank account. We were completely unaware this company even existed, never mind that they hold our bank details. Do you not think if we had signed up for a complete savings membership, which involves a monthly fee, that we would maybe use it??? This is completely unacceptable! You say the only way to become a member is by entering your details on the sign-up form and agreeing to the terms and conditions of the programme yet this is obviously not made clear?! How else do you explain so many consumers being unknowingly signed up, unaware a membership fee is being taken from their bank accounts? My partner has phoned complete savings today who were very rude and unhelpful, he was basically just fobbed off but I will not be fobbed off as it is very wrong what you are doing! We are not paying for something we have not used and did not sign up for! I await a response and instructions on how to claim a full refund. Many thanks

Unaware signed up of complete savings

Extremely shocked to discover that complete savings have been deducting £10 continuously for the last 5 years! I have emailed and asked for a refund but they only gave back a month worth of the refund. And they said I joined the membership after completing the travelodge online transaction. This isn’t fair to the consumers and I can’t afford to lose this £600.

Avoid this company at all costs.

Shortly after making a purchase on any number of sites you will often see an ad for a company called Complete Savings. They offer discounts at various online shops. Do not sign up for this. Don't even click on any of their links. Simply by filling out a form and giving them your email address you will be signing up to their service, and if you sign up for their 'service' (which I have never used) you will the be agreeing to allow them to surreptitiously debit your card £15 per month unless you actively call them an cancel it. I feel that this was not made clear to me. I would like a full refund. I will also be taking this up with the ombudsman.
